This morning, May 6,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h chaired a meeting between the Government Standing Committee and the Hanoi Party Committee Standing Committee.

Reporting at the conference, Chairman of Hanoi People's Committee Tran Sy Thanh pointed out the city's positive economic results such as GRDP in the first quarter increased by 5.8%; total state budget revenue in the area was nearly 178,000 billion VND, up 21.6% over the same period last year; accumulated in the first 4 months of the year, attracting 1.7 billion USD of FDI capital (equal to the whole year of 2022).
Regarding the key tasks in the coming time, Hanoi leaders said the city will continue to develop urban infrastructure synchronously; review and thoroughly handle projects with slow progress in land use.
Hanoi will speed up the construction of Ring Road 4; urban railway projects; and renovate and rebuild old apartment buildings.
Hanoi City leaders also made proposals and recommendations to the Government, Prime Minister and ministries and branches about 9 railway routes in the area.
For the Nhon - Hanoi Railway Station railway project, the progress has reached about 76.5%, the city is striving to complete the elevated section in 2023. Hanoi has requested the Prime Minister to allow payment from the budget's advance capital to disburse payments to contractors and consultants of the project.
The Van Cao - Ngoc Khanh - Lang Hoa Lac urban railway project has a total investment of about 65,000 billion VND. Hanoi has proposed that the Government consider and prioritize the use of ODA capital to invest in the project.
In addition, Hanoi also proposed that the Government allow research and implementation of the investment project to build the Ha Dong - Xuan Mai railway line from ODA capital to ensure technical and technological synchronization with the section (Cat Linh - Ha Dong) currently in operation...
Consider speeding up the consultation process to complete the procedure for adjusting the investment policy of the Nam Thang Long - Tran Hung Dao railway project in 2023.
The Ministry of Transport needs to urgently hand over documents to the city for management according to the railway network system planning for the period 2021 - 2030, with a vision to 2050, to implement the Yen Vien - Ngoc Hoi railway line.

Concluding the conference,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h assigned the Ministry of Planning and Investment to handle procedural problems, the Ministry of Finance on capital, and the Ministry of Transport on the route of Hanoi urban railway projects, to be completed in the second quarter.
In addition, regarding Hanoi's proposal to decide on changing the land use purpose from 10 hectares of rice fields or more to non-agricultural land in accordance with the planning, this is the content that many localities have proposed. The Prime Minister assigned ministries and branches to urgently report to competent authorities to consider issuing appropriate resolutions.
The Head of Government also requested to urgently complete the Hanoi Capital Planning for the 2021-2030 period, with a vision to 2050; and adjust the overall Hanoi Capital Construction Master Plan to 2045 and a vision to 2065.
Organize and implement urban planning well, both modern and unique, expanding development space, promoting the potential and strengths of the city.
Focus on improving the business investment environment, supporting business development, promoting start-ups and innovation; promptly removing difficulties, supporting and creating conditions for businesses to promote production and business development, creating jobs and livelihoods for people...
The Prime Minister also assigned very specific tasks to ministries and branches to handle 31 recommendations from Hanoi; hoping that the capital will further promote the spirit of self-reliance, self-improvement, innovation, daring to think, daring to do; building and developing comprehensively, quickly, sustainably, and culturally, becoming a model of socio-economic development for the whole country.
